Bugatti continues its Legends Edition series withe the Veyron Vitesse “Jean Bugatti” model that made debut at the 2013 Frankfurt Motor Show.
Like the name tells, this special edition Veyron pays tribute to the company founder’s son Jean Bugatti, which was also the creator of the Type 57SC Atlantic model.
As Bugatti accustomed us so far, the cool features on the “Jean” edition are strictly related to the visual aspect. This way, the whole body is made from jet-black clear-coated carbon fiber, while the metallic highlights are made out of platinum. Jean Bugatti’s signature has been lasered onto the gasoline and oil cap, while the 57SC Atlantic’s silhouette has been embroidered on the door panels, contrasting with the very nice brown/beige upholstery.
